Hardware Essentials

Choosing the right workstation involves balancing several hardware components rather than focusing on a single specification.

  • Multi-core processors accelerate simulations and rendering tasks.
  • Fast NVMe SSD storage reduces loading and caching times.
  • High-capacity RAM supports larger scenes and simulations.
  • Professional graphics cards improve viewport responsiveness.
  • Efficient cooling maintains consistent performance during extended workloads.

When these components work together efficiently, users experience smoother project execution and improved overall stability, even during demanding production schedules.

Graphics Performance

Graphics hardware contributes significantly to viewport interaction and real-time visualization. Although many simulation processes rely heavily on the processor, an efficient graphics card enhances navigation through dense scenes.

Storage Efficiency

Fast storage solutions improve both daily productivity and project organization. Quick file access reduces downtime while opening scenes, saving projects, and loading simulation caches.

  • NVMe SSDs provide extremely fast read and write performance.
  • Dedicated cache drives improve simulation efficiency.
  • Secondary storage protects completed project files.
  • Regular backups reduce the risk of unexpected data loss.
  • Organized storage simplifies long-term project management.

Reliable storage infrastructure supports uninterrupted creative work while ensuring valuable production assets remain secure throughout every stage of development.
